Marina del Rey Crowd-Source Video Company Receives $15 Million Investment

Tongal connects companies directly with the public to execute marketing campaigns.

Tongal, a Marina del Rey-based company that connects advertisers with user-created videos, secured a $15 million investment on Monday.

The crowd-source video company was founded in 2008 with the belief that good ideas should be conceptualized and vetted by the public. Tongal allows writers, directors and animators to create videos for brands that need original content for advertising purposes.

The creative project begins with the “idea round” where companies select the best submission ideas for a particular marketing project. Then, the ideas move in the competition process and more technically-skilled filmmakers help bring the ideas to fruition.

A prize pool is distributed among the winners of a selected project. To date, Tongal users have earned more than $3 million, according to the company.

“Our brand customers are thrilled with the quality and in-market performance of videos being produced on Tongal, as well the unexpected and fresh ideas that emerge,” said James DeJulio, president of Tongal. “Tongal enables businesses to expand beyond the thinking within the four walls of their organizations, and provides the opportunity to unlock and access the world’s creativity — this is very powerful.”

The $15 million cash infusion provided by Insight Venture Partners will be used to accelerate the build-out of a global community of Tongal users.

“Tongal’s customers told us how the company’s robust community, coupled with Tongal’s delivery platform, offers brand marketers a unique opportunity to satisfy their need for high-quality, innovative, and inspiring content,” said Jeff Lieberman, managing director at Insight Venture Partners. “All this occurs at lower cost and with faster time to market – something truly differentiated among marketing solutions. We are excited to work with Rob, James, and the team as they scale Tongal.”

Tongal is headquartered at 4063 Glencoe Ave. in Marina del Rey.
